Corporate Law

As a decision-maker in business, you cannot afford to waste time. That is why, almost uniquely in the legal sector, we give you direct and regular access to senior lawyers.

Your main contact is one of our leading partners, who has taken the time to learn your business and, where necessary, engages other experts to answer your questions and solve legal issues in a commercially focussed and pragmatic manner.

In fact, we aim to be part of your team, enabling you to get on with your transactions, run and expand your business. In this way, we not only assist you in avoiding headaches, but we also help you save time and money.

Completing over 1,000 deals annually, with a total value of more than £1billion, we are ranked among the best. Our services include:

  • Corporate M&A transactions
  • Private equity investments 
  • Corporate insolvency matters
  • Corporate restructuring
  • Buying or selling a business
  • Joint venture structuring (company, partnership, LLP or contractual) 
  • Drafting and reviewing commercial contracts (agency, distribution, franchising etc)
